Siemens Turkey achieved an annual cost savings of 400 thousand euros and a reduction of approximately 4 thousand tons of carbon emissions at Starwood Forest Products Facilities. Transforming the present for the future, Siemens Turkey continues to make significant contributions to sustainability and savings targets with tailor-made energy efficiency projects it offers to companies. With the energy efficiency project carried out by Siemens Turkey at Starwood Forest Products Facilities, energy savings of up to 68 percent in production, annual cost savings of over 400 thousand euros and a reduction of approximately 4 thousand tons of carbon emissions were achieved.

Supporting its customers to achieve their goals with more sustainable methods and using less resources, with energy efficiency projects specially prepared for every institution and organization in need, Siemens Turkey has added a new one to these efforts. In this context, realizing the energy efficiency project in 13 different units at the Starwood İnegöl Factory, which has the highest production volume under one roof in the Turkish integrated wood industry, Siemens Turkey achieved energy savings of up to 68 percent in production. With the project, which also started the works implemented for the first time in the world during the production phase, annual cost savings of over 400 thousand euros and a reduction of approximately 4 thousand tons of carbon emissions were achieved.

Kerim Oal, General Manager of Siemens Türkiye Digital Industries: “The investment amount of 30 percent of the projects has been supported by the state. Indicating that the innovative solutions offered by Siemens Turkey, on the one hand, ensure a more efficient use of resources, on the other hand, they improve the production processes of companies and give them a competitive advantage, Siemens Turkey Digital Industries General Manager Kerim Oal said: Our customers, whose energy consumption has decreased significantly with these projects, can achieve significant cost savings.” Stating that two of the 13 projects carried out by Siemens Turkey at the Starwood İnegöl Factory were the first in the world, Oal continued his words as follows:

“Siemens Turkey is one of the Energy Efficiency Consulting companies licensed by the Ministry of Energy and Natural Resources, General Directorate of Renewable Energy. Within the scope of this consultancy, we have been included in the incentive program by preparing VAP (Efficiency Enhancing Project) for projects. Thus, we enabled the government to support 30 percent of the investment made by Starwood Forest Products.”

Starwood Forest Products Project Manager Nuri Önlü: “We contributed to our responsibility towards nature by creating a significant environmental impact with the project”

Starwood Project Manager Nuri Önlü, who stated that one of the most critical issues at Starwood, where a high amount of production takes place, is the coordination of stoppage planning and commissioning, said, “This coordination was made very successfully by the expert teams of Siemens Turkey, and the project was implemented on time. In this direction, automation and software applications focused on production processes; applications for driver applications and efficient motor conversion, which no other technology provider in the world has, were successfully carried out. Our work was completed with 1 projects implemented, 13 of which was process improvement to increase quality. Thanks to Siemens energy efficiency services, most of the projects were included in the VAP (Efficiency Enhancing Project) incentive mechanism by the Ministry of Energy, and with an investment of 530 thousand euros, we achieved an annual savings of 7 million 140 thousand kWh and a profit of 403 thousand euros.
